MMI (Man-Machine Interface) code is used to generate USSD request from the keyboard of a mobile device. It starts with an asterisk and ends with a hash. When performing more complex queries within code, an asterisk is used to separate parameters.
We usually use such combinations when requesting information about balance, expiration date, when replenishing an account, etc.
Sometimes, when performing such a request, an error is displayed on the screen: “Connection problem or invalid MMI code.”
Below are some ways to resolve this error:

1. Problem with the SIM card

Like all electronic products, the SIM card is subject to physical wear and tear and may not function correctly. To correct the connection error, you must contact the service center to replace the card. However, the phone number will remain the same. It is recommended to replace the SIM card every 2 years.

2. Insufficient coverage or unstable 3G operation
Mobile operators are constantly improving their coverage capabilities and using third-generation 3G communications, but it does not always work as expected.
Modern telephone sets are also predisposed to modernization. For this reason, by default they use the option automatic connection to GSM/WCDMA. But with 3G connectivity interruptions, this network is not always stable.
To eliminate the error when there is insufficient coverage, you need to set the GSM network as follows:
- go to the phone settings;
- then go to the “Network” menu and select “Mobile networks”;
- in the “Network mode” setting, change the network mode to “GSM only”;
- reboot the phone.
This mode does not have to be changed permanently. After a while, try turning on the previous network mode again.
3. Some applications work

Some externally downloaded applications may cause an error with connection problems or an incorrect MMI code. To confirm or refute this suspicion, boot your device into safe mode and try to make a request to the operator. If it goes well, it means that some application installed on the phone is to blame and will need to be removed.

4. Problems with device settings
Incorrect device settings or malfunctions may cause problems with the MMI connection.

Try rebooting the device, and if the problem persists, try full reset data.
Go to “Settings” - “Backup and reset” - “Reset to factory settings”. Please note - all data on the device will be lost!
5. Temporary problems with the mobile operator
In this case, all you have to do is wait. You can call the operator and find out how long the error with MMI will persist.

A few words about the MMI code itself. The MMI code is used to generate a USSD request from a mobile device. Such a request always begins with an asterisk and ends with a hash, for example, *100#.

Mobile operators have long begun to use USSD requests with different codes to perform actions on the phone number from which the request is sent. For example, using a USSD request, we receive information about the current balance and tariffs, send free messages asking to call back, etc.

The error “Connection problem or invalid MMI code” can occur for several reasons:

1. Outdated USSD request. If you enter a USSD request, make sure on the operator’s website that the request you entered is not outdated and entered correctly.

2. . Quite often, users, having connected communication services from an operator many years ago, forget that the SIM card is also subject to physical wear and tear. If your SIM card is more than two years old, contact the nearest store of your operator to exchange the SIM card for a new one. As a rule, this service is completely free.

3. Insufficient 3G/4G coverage. Unfortunately, in our country there is a significant lag in the development of mobile Internet. If large Russian cities already have high-speed 4G Internet, then in some regions mobile internet may be completely absent.

If you notice that the 3G or 4G network is working intermittently, periodically connecting to GSM/WCDMA, then all this may lead to the “Connection problem or invalid MMI code” error.
